Reviews from 'Get Your Paws on a Good Book' participants

Everyman by Philip Roth: George Guidall is very good at reading a recorded book. I enjoyed this book because the author reallly got into this man's feelings about his life. He realized he didn't make the best decisions in his life.

The Da Vinci Code by Dan Brown: Remember it's fictional and read the book for the word puzzles and interesting Da Vinci insights.

What My Mother Doesn't Know by Sonya Sones: This is written in poems. It's about a girl's love life, and her friends and family. She is fourteen.

Imaginary Men by Anjali Banerjee: Very cute story. Easy to read.

New on our Web for the week ending July 7, 2006

Homework

  • S.O.S. Mathematics "a high-quality resource for persons who might find themselves in need of a bit of refresher on topics ranging from algebra to differential equations. " (SR)

Leisure

  • Pump Guide "The Pump Guide is an online directory of gas stations statewide that offer travelers with disabilities full service at self-service prices. Created by the Michigan Paralyzed Veterans of America." (RT)

Teacher Resources

  • ESL Cyber Listening Lab "Developed by an educator with a series of experiences spent educating persons in the art of learning English, this website provides a multimedia experience for those seeking to learn the language." (SR)
